Receiving No Number Calls since Full Fibre with Digital Voice Upgrade

Around three weeks ago I had an upgrade to Full Fibre with Digital Voice. Ever since then I've been receiving No Number calls twice every hour. The phone doesn't actually ring but shows as a no number missed call.
The calls occurred at three minutes and thirtrythree minutes past the hour. But recently changed to four minutes and thirtyfour minutes pas the hour, so 13:04 and 13:34 for example.
I believe it's coming from some automated system on TalkTalk's end, testing the line for example.
I have reported it to to TalkTalk three weeks ago and the operator at the time agreed that it does seem to be the case of a phone line test from them. I've since contacted TalkTalk several times about this for an update but they aren't getting back to me at all. Please can someone look into this for me.
